Initial Court Appearance and Charges
📌 The individual, Mr. Jones, is facing charges for possession of a weapon during a violent crime and murder.
⚖️ The weapon charge carries a potential sentence of up to five years and/or a fine, while the murder charge can result in life imprisonment or death.
🗓️ Mr. Jones' next appearance date is scheduled for March 9th at 9:00 AM at the courthouse at 109 Park Avenue.
Rights and Legal Representation
🗣️ Mr. Jones was advised of his right to an attorney; if he cannot afford one, he can be screened for a court-appointed attorney based on income and federal guidelines.
🚫 Although initially stating he didn't need one, he was pre-qualified for a public defender due to being unemployed.
📜 He has the right to request a preliminary hearing where the state must establish probable cause, or he could face indictment by a grand jury. Failure to request this hearing by March 9th may waive his right to it.
Bond Conditions and Next Steps
🛑 A bond of $10,000 was set only for the weapon possession charge; bond for the murder charge cannot be set by this court and requires a circuit court judge.
🚫 A mandatory condition set is no contact (including electronic communication or third-party contact) with the family of the alleged victim.
🛑 Even after a bond is set for murder, Mr. Jones may remain detained due to an additional hold from another county.
